What is a Cable?

The Cable Length, or cable, is a nautical unit of measure equal to one tenth of a nautical mile or approximately 100 fathoms.

What is a Nautical Mile?

The Nautical Mile (nmi) is a unit of length used in air, marine, and space navigation. It is exactly 1,852 meters, derived from one minute of latitude.

How to Convert Cable to Nautical Mile

To convert Cable to Nautical Mile, divide the Cable value by 10.

nmi = cb ÷ 10
